From the U.S., company startup prices, outlined as expenses incurred to research the potential of creating or acquiring an active business and charges to build an Energetic enterprise, can only be amortized under certain ailments. They have to be expenditures which are deducted as business bills if incurred by an existing Energetic company and have to be incurred ahead of the active small business commences.
Samples of these costs involve consulting service fees, financial Assessment of prospective acquisitions, advertising and marketing expenditures, and payments to workers, all of which need to be incurred before the business is considered active. In accordance with IRS recommendations, initial startup fees need to be amortized.

An amortization agenda (often known as an amortization table) is usually a table detailing Every single periodic payment on an amortizing loan. Each individual calculation performed through the calculator will also include an once-a-year and every month amortization plan higher than. Each repayment for an amortized loan will comprise the two an curiosity payment and payment in the direction of the principal equilibrium, which differs for each spend interval.
There's two standard definitions of amortization. The primary is definitely the systematic repayment of the loan after some time. The next is used in the context of business accounting and is particularly the act of spreading the cost of a costly and prolonged-lived item around several periods. Sure firms occasionally purchase high-priced objects which can be utilized for extensive amounts of time which might be categorised as investments. Things that are commonly amortized for the purpose of spreading expenditures involve equipment, buildings, and machines. From an accounting standpoint, a sudden obtain of an expensive manufacturing unit for the duration of a quarterly period can skew the financials, so its value is amortized around the expected lifetime of the manufacturing facility alternatively.
